Day 1: Departure
Board your overnight flight to Sri Lanka

Day 2: Arrive in Colombo
Arriving around midday in Colombo, transfer to your hotel.

Day 3: Dambulla
Leave Colombo and head through the countryside to the Dambulla Cave Temples, one of the country’s most treasured religious landmarks. Explore the caves adorned with frescoes and Buddha Statues before heading to your hotel. Here, enjoy a poolside drinks reception before dinner.

Day 4: Sigiriya Rock
This morning, visit the breathtaking monument of Sigiriya, a huge granite fortress topped with ruins of an ancient royal palace. On your way towards the rock, you’ll get the chance to see the ‘Cloud Maidens’, a series of beautiful frescoes. The afternoon is free to spend as you wish.

Day 5: Kandy
Set off towards Kandy, the former royal capital. Along the way, stop at a spice garden before arriving in the afternoon. Check into your hotel and enjoy the rest of the day at leisure.

Day 6: Kandy
Begin your day of exploration with a visit to the Temple of the Tooth, the holiest Buddhist shrine in Sri Lanka where you may witness once of the ceremonies that take place here. Then, take a relaxing boat ride on the Mahaweli River. During this, an expert naturalist will explain the biodiversity that thrives along its banks. This afternoon, take a stroll through the immense Botanical Gardens, home to thousands of exotic plants. This evening, enjoy a performance of traditional Sri Lankan dance.

Day 7: Journey to Nuwara Eliya
Head to Nuwara Eliya this morning arriving in the afternoon after passing through the mountains and into the tea plantations. On arrival, check into your hotel.

Day 8: Elephant Transit Home
Journey south to reach the Elephant Transit Home in Udawalawe National Park. Here, you’ll have the chance to watch young elephants being fed before transferring to your hotel.

Day 9: Yala National Park
Early this morning, set off on a safari through Yala National Park. Keep your eyes out for leopards, elephants, sloth bears and numerous birds. Return for a late breakfast before having the rest of the day leisure.

Day 10: Kalutara
After breakfast, head back towards the west coast, stopping on route for a tour of the city of Galle, known for its Dutch Fort. In the afternoon, you’ll arrive at a 5* resort

Days 11-12: Free Day
Enjoy 2 days relaxing at the hotel

Day 13: Return home
Transfer to the airport for your flight back to the UK
